diff --git a/Gemfile.lock b/Gemfile.lock index 8cd9fbaa..c55445fe 100644 --- a/Gemfile.lock +++ b/Gemfile.lock @@ -1,8 +1,7 @@ PATH remote: . specs: - workos (0.8.0) - require_all (~> 3.0.0) + workos (0.8.1) sorbet-runtime (~> 0.5) GEM @@ -27,7 +26,6 @@ GEM public_suffix (4.0.2) rainbow (3.0.0) rake (13.0.1) - require_all (3.0.0) rspec (3.9.0) rspec-core (~> 3.9.0) rspec-expectations (~> 3.9.0) diff --git a/lib/workos/types.rb b/lib/workos/types.rb index d42100e9..b0fefcf9 100644 --- a/lib/workos/types.rb +++ b/lib/workos/types.rb @@ -1,11 +1,16 @@ # frozen_string_literal: true - -require 'require_all' +# typed: strong module WorkOS # WorkOS believes strongly in typed languages, # so we're using Sorbet throughout this Ruby gem. module Types - require_all 'lib/workos/types' + require_relative 'types/connection_struct' + require_relative 'types/intent_enum' + require_relative 'types/list_struct' + require_relative 'types/organization_struct' + require_relative 'types/passwordless_session_struct' + require_relative 'types/profile_struct' + require_relative 'types/provider_enum' end end diff --git a/lib/workos/version.rb b/lib/workos/version.rb index 615077df..fccf6e98 100644 --- a/lib/workos/version.rb +++ b/lib/workos/version.rb @@ -2,5 +2,5 @@ # typed: strong module WorkOS - VERSION = '0.8.0' + VERSION = '0.8.1' end diff --git a/workos.gemspec b/workos.gemspec index 41fdd17a..e4eda948 100644 --- a/workos.gemspec +++ b/workos.gemspec @@ -22,7 +22,6 @@ Gem::Specification.new do |spec| spec.test_files = spec.files.grep(%r{^(test|spec|features)/}) spec.require_paths = ['lib'] - spec.add_dependency 'require_all', '~> 3.0.0' spec.add_dependency 'sorbet-runtime', '~> 0.5' spec.add_development_dependency 'bundler', '>= 2.0.1'